Quyon Ferry open for the season
The Quyon Ferry opened for the season this past weekend, on March 25. The ferry is open seven days a week, bringing up to 21 cars at a time between Quyon and Fitzroy Harbour Ontario. Owner Ralph McColgan said that he’s seen an increase in usage due to construction on the Champlain Bridge in Aylmer. […]

Former MP Amos billed Commons $11,500 for transition from public office
Former Pontiac MP Will Amos billed taxpayers more than $10,000 for an executive training course months after he left office. MPs who do not seek re-election or are not re-elected are entitled to up to $15,000 in transition expenses such as career training or education “to help them re-establish themselves”.
